Is the 2004 Mustang Cobra supercharged?
The 2004 SVT Mustang Cobra’s 4.6-liter, DOHC V-8 is equipped with a Roots-type Eaton™ supercharger and aluminum alloy cylinder heads with high-flow capacity. The engine produces 390 horsepower at 6,000 rpm and 390 foot-pounds of torque at 3,500 rpm. The Cobra engine is built on a cast-iron block for strength.

What kind of suspension does a 2004 Mustang Cobra have?
The chassis of the 2004 SVT Mustang Cobra is highlighted by its exclusive independent rear suspension with upper and lower control arms, Bilstein monotube dampers, coil springs and a 26 mm tubular stabilizer bar.
When did the Ford Mustang SVT Cobra come out?
The SVT Cobra was succeeded by the 2007 Shelby GT500 . The 1993 Ford Mustang SVT Cobra was launched during the 1992 Chicago Auto Show. It was the premier vehicle of Ford’s newly established SVT division, designed to showcase SVT’s four hallmarks of performance, substance, exclusivity, and value.

What kind of transmission does a 2001 Mustang Cobra have?
The 2001 Cobra now was equipped with Tremec’s TR-3650 5-speed Transmission instead of the T45 5-Speed that was used in 1999. The 2001 car was also upgraded with 31 Spline Axleshafts and Differential compared to the 28 Spline for 1999.
